282 |
running bit timer. There is one bit running from 0000.0000.0000.0001
to 1000.0000.0000.0000 in about 6 seconds. Used for flashlights. |
284 |
crash code (decimal). If you set one of these values FS will detect a crash.
2 | mountain crash |
4 | crash |
8 | splash |
14 | building crash |
16 | crash with other aircraft (ignored in FS6) |
|
288 |
Aircraft is in fuelbox flag. Set it to 1 and your fuel tanks are filled. Aircraft
speed must be nearly zero, otherwise FS5 ignores this flag. |
28A |
FS version number, BCD coded.
hex/bcd | decimal | version |
0500 | 1280 | 5.0 |
0510 | 1296 | 5.1 |
0600 | 1536 | 6.0/FS95 |
|
28C |
Time of day code
1 | day |
2 | dusk/dawn |
4 | night |
|

346 |
scenery density code
0 | very sparse |
1 | sparse |
2 | normal |
3 | dense |
4 | very dense |
5 | extremely dense (FS2000) |
|

6F8 |
season code (northern hemisphere)
0 = winter
1 = spring
2 = summer
3 = autum
